Transaction ff33375806a9e4a85e427819f89e1688d6f8cae56da706b248b81a4c95c9a83a
1 Input
1 Output
-
ff33375806a9e4a85e427819f89e1688d6f8cae56da706b248b81a4c95c9a83a:0
- value
- 2656604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8737dbf93ad9882415350a23e576793b194a792 OP_EQUAL
- address
- 3KxuRNxZq3R4WhatLBcfsAY8Sdu6de4Bho